New Delhi, Mar 6 (PTI) Coriander prices on Wednesday eased Rs 34 to Rs 8,172 per quintal in futures trade as speculators reduced their positions amid a weak demand in the spot market.

On the National Commodity and Derivatives Exchange, coriander contracts for the April delivery declined Rs 34, or 0.42 per cent, to Rs 8,172 per quintal in 21,790 lots.

Market analysts said subdued demand in the spot market mainly led to the decline in coriander prices here.
